Description
A rectangular plaque with wooden backboard based is mounted on the cairn. The inscription depicts the event of incident, casualties and the event of commemoration.
Inscription
IN MEMORIAM/ ON 26TH FEBRUARY 1885, NEAR THIS SPOT, A 6 INCH SHELL BEING PREPARED/ FOR FIRING, DETONATED, KILLING./ COLONEL W A FOX - STRANGWAYS COMMANDANT AND SUPERINTENDENT/ OF EXPERIMENTS./ COLONEL F LYONS SUPERINTENDENT, ROYAL LABORATORY,/ WOOLWICH./ CAPTAIN F M GOOLD - ADAMS ASSISTANT SUPERINTENDENT OF/ EXPERIMENTS./ SERGEANT MAJOR S DAYKIN/ GUNNER R ALLEN/ GUNNER J UNDERWOOD/ ARTIFICER RANCE/ THIS MEMORIAL WAS UNVEILED BY COLONEL R A SPACKMAN, SUPERINTENDENT./ PROOF AND EXPERIMENTAL ESTABLISHMENT, SHOEBURYNESS ON 26 FEBRUARY 1985./ THERE IS ALSO A PLAQUE COMMEMORATING THE EVENT IN THE GARRISON CHURCH.
